TABLE 1. Gross Heating Values (GHV) and Net Heating Values (NHV)

Fuel Gas kcal/Nm³ kcal/kg
   GHV NHV GHV NHV
Hydrogen 3050  2570 33889 28555
Methane 9530 8570  13284 11946
Ethane 16700 15300 12400 11350
Ethylene 15100 14200 12020 11270
Natural Gas from Campos 10060 9090 16206 14642
Natural Gas from Santos 10687  9672 15955 14440
Natural Gas from Bolivia 9958 8993 16494 14896
Propane 24200 22250 12030 11080
Propylene 22400 20900 11700 10940
n-Butane 31900 29400  11830 10930
iso-Butane 31700 29200 11810 10900
Butylene-1 29900 27900 11580 10830
iso-Pentane (liquid) - - 11600 10730
LPG (average) 28000  25775 11920 10997
Acetylene 13980 13490 11932 11514
Carbon Monoxide 3014 3014  2411 2411

 

 

TABLE 2. Density and Specific Gravity

Fuel Gas Density Specific Gravity
(kg/Nm³) (air = 1)
Air 1,29 1,00
Hydrogen 0,09 0,07
Methane 0,72 0,56
Ethane 1,35 1,05
Ethylene 1,26 0,98
Natural Gas from Campos 0,79 0,61
Natural Gas from Santos 0,83 0,64
Natural Gas from Bolivia 0,78 0,60
Propane 2,01 1,56
Propylene 1,91 1,48
n-Butane 2,69 2,09
iso-Butane 2,68 2,08
Butylene-1 2,58 2,00
LPG (average) 2,35 1,82
Acetylene 1,17 0,91
Carbon Monoxide 1,25 0,97

 

 

TABLE 3. Wobbe Index

Fuel Gas Upper Wobbe Index Lower Wobbe Index
  (kcal/Nm³) (kcal/Nm³)
Hydrogen 11528 9714
Methane 12735 11452
Ethane 16298 14931
Ethylene 15253 14344
Natural Gas from Campos 12837 11597
Natural Gas from Santos 13307 12043
Natural Gas from Bolívia 12834 11591
Propane 19376 17814
Propylene 18413 17180
n-Butane 22066 20336
iso-Butane 21980 20247
Butylene-1 21142 19728
LPG (average) 20755 19106
Acetylene 14655 14141
Carbon Monoxide 3060 3060

 

 

TABLE 4. Adiabatic Flame Temperature (gas, air and oxygen at 20ºC)

Fuel Gas Air (ºC) Oxygen (ºC)
Methane 1957 2810
Ethane 1960 -
Propane 1980 2820
Butane 1970 -
Hydrogen 2045 2660
Acetylene 2400 3100

 

 

TABLE 5. Minimum Autoignition Temperature (fuel gas,air and oxygen at atmospheric pressure)

Fuel Gas Air (ºC) Oxygen (ºC)
Methane 580 555
Ethane 515 -
Propane 480 470
Butane 420 285
Carbon Monoxide 630 -
Hydrogen 570 560
Acetylene 305 296

 

 

TABLE 6. Flammability Limits or Explosive Limits (fuel gas, air and oxygen at 20ºC and at atmospheric pressure)

Fuel Gas Air Oxygen
Limits Lower (%) Upper (%) Lower (%) Upper (%)
Methane 5,0 15,0 5,0 60,0
Ethane 3,0 12,4 3,0 66,0
Ethylene 2,7 36,0 2,9 80,0
Propane 2,8 9,5 2,3 45,0
Propylene 2,0 11,1 2,1 52,8
Butane 1,8 8,4 1,8 40,0
Carbon Monoxide 12,0 75,0 - -
Hydrogen 4,0 75,0 4,0 94,0
Acetylene 2,2 80 / 85(*) 2,8 93,0
(*) Different book references.

 

 

TABLE 7. Flame Speeds

Fuel Gas Air Oxygen
  (m/sec) (m/sec)
Methane 0,4 3,9
Propane 0,45 / 0,5 3,3 / 3,9
Butane 0,35 3,3
Acetylene 1,46 7,6
Hydrogen 2,66 14,35

TABLE 9. Perfect Combustion with Air

Fuel Gas Air Required Combustion Products
  (Nm³ air / Nm³ gas) (Nm³ c.p. / Nm³ gas)
Carbon Monoxide 2,40 2,90
Methane 9,62 10,62
Acetylene 12,02 12,52
Ethylene 14,42 15,42
Ethane 16,83 18,33
Propylene 21,36 23,13
Propane 24,04 26,04
Butylene 28,85 30,85
Butane 31,25 33,75
Hydrogen 2,40 2,90

 

 

TABLE 10. Perfect Combustion with Oxygen

Fuel Gas Oxygen Required Combustion Products
  (Nm³ O2 / Nm³ gas) (Nm³ c.p. / Nm³ gas)
Carbon Monoxide 0,50 1,00
Methane 2,00 3,00
Acetylene 2,50 3,00
Ethylene 3,00 4,00
Ethane 3,50 5,00
Propylene 4,50 6,00
Propane 5,00 7,00
Butylene 6,00 8,00
Butane 6,50 9,00
Hydrogen 0,50 1,00
